Understanding Replacement Diplomas

A replacement diploma is an official duplicate of an original diploma issued by an educational institution. It serves as a valid replacement when the original document is lost, stolen, damaged, or destroyed. Many individuals require replacement diplomas for job applications, continuing education, or personal records. Understanding the process and requirements for obtaining one is essential.

Why You Might Need a Replacement Diploma

There are several reasons why someone might need a replacement diploma:

  1. Loss or Theft: Diplomas can be misplaced or stolen, making it necessary to obtain a replacement.
  2. Damage or Wear: Over time, diplomas may suffer from water damage, tearing, or fading.
  3. Name Change: Those who legally change their names may request a new diploma reflecting the updated name.
  4. Duplicate Copy: Some people request an additional copy for display or professional use.

How to Obtain a Replacement Diploma

The process of obtaining a replacement diploma varies by institution but generally involves the following steps:

  1. Contact the Issuing Institution: Reach out to the school, college, or university that issued the original diploma.
  2. Complete an Application: Most institutions require a formal request, which can be done online or via mail.
  3. Provide Identification: Schools often request proof of identity, such as a government-issued ID or student records.
  4. Pay Fees: Many institutions charge a fee for processing and printing the replacement diploma.
  5. Wait for Processing: Depending on the institution, processing times can range from a few weeks to several months.
